What to wear to Sri Lanka now?
What should I wear to Sri Lanka? Here, we offer some suggestions for the clothes you take when you travel to Sri Lanka. Sri Lanka is located in the south of the South Asian subcontinent and an island country in the Indian Ocean. The northwest faces the Indian Peninsula across the Baucau Strait, close to the equator, with four seasons like summer. Sri Lanka has a tropical monsoon climate, with an average maximum temperature of 365,438+0 and an average minimum temperature of 24 in coastal areas. The highest average temperature in mountainous area is 26, and the lowest average temperature is 16. There are no four seasons in Sri Lanka, only rainy and dry seasons. March-April and September 9- 10/0 are dry seasons, with less rain, which is the best season for tourism in Sri Lanka. The rainy season is from May to August, 165438+ 10 to February of the following year. The southwest monsoon and northeast monsoon pass through Sri Lanka, and there is more rain. The annual temperature in the coastal cities of Sri Lanka is 29-3 1, and it is slightly cooler in the central mountainous areas. It will be a little cold in the mountains at night. Therefore, when you don't travel to Sri Lanka, you don't have to worry about bringing heavy clothes. You can start your trip to Sri Lanka with several sets of summer clothes and a coat. In Sri Lanka, most people believe in Buddhism, and many habits are related to Buddhism. You should be barefoot when entering the temple, and you can't wear shoes and socks. So when you travel to Sri Lanka, you must bring a pair of shoes and socks that are easy to put on and take off. In addition, the Sri Lankan concept is relatively conservative. Therefore, it is recommended not to wear sexy clothes when traveling in Sri Lanka, except at the seaside. Sri Lanka has four seasons like summer and strong ultraviolet rays. You can wear a beautiful hat, which is very good for your facial skin.
